Autonomous Vehicles: The Road to Self-Driving

One of the most significant advancements in automotive technology is the development of autonomous vehicles. Companies like Tesla, Waymo, and traditional automakers are investing heavily in self-driving technology. Autonomous vehicles, once a futuristic concept, are becoming increasingly viable due to advances in AI, machine learning, and sensor technologies. While fully autonomous vehicles are still in development, we can anticipate more widespread adoption of semi-autonomous features, such as adaptive cruise control and lane-keeping assistance, in the near future.

The potential benefits of autonomous vehicles are immense. They promise to reduce traffic accidents caused by human error, increase fuel efficiency, and provide mobility solutions for those unable to drive. Furthermore, autonomous vehicles could revolutionize transportation logistics, making goods delivery faster and more efficient.

Electric Vehicles: Driving Towards Sustainability

The shift towards electric vehicles (EVs) is another pivotal trend shaping the future of the automotive industry. As concerns about climate change and environmental sustainability grow, automakers are committing to reducing their carbon footprint by transitioning from internal combustion engines to electric propulsion. Companies like Tesla, Nissan, and Volkswagen are leading the charge, producing electric vehicles that are not only eco-friendly but also increasingly affordable and efficient.

Advancements in battery technology are key to the success of electric vehicles. Innovations such as solid-state batteries are expected to provide longer range, faster charging times, and improved safety over traditional lithium-ion batteries. As charging infrastructure continues to expand, range anxiety will diminish, making electric vehicles a practical choice for more consumers.

Connected Car Technologies: Enhancing the Driving Experience

Connected car technologies are creating a seamless integration between vehicles and their digital ecosystems. Modern cars are equipped with advanced infotainment systems, telematics, and in-car internet connectivity, transforming them into smart devices on wheels. This connectivity allows for real-time traffic updates, entertainment streaming, remote diagnostics, and enhanced safety features.

The Internet of Things (IoT) is further enabling vehicles to communicate with each other and with infrastructure, leading to improvements in traffic management and accident prevention. Vehicle-to-everything (V2X) communication will play an essential role in facilitating the safe coexistence of autonomous and human-driven vehicles, creating more efficient and safer transportation networks.

The Evolution of In-Car Experience

As technology integrates further into the automotive industry, the in-car experience is poised to undergo significant changes. Personalization will become a focal point, with vehicles adapting to the preferences and habits of individual drivers and passengers. Augmented reality (AR) displays, voice recognition, and advanced driver-assistance systems (ADAS) will enhance user interfaces and make driving more intuitive.

Furthermore, the rise of shared mobility services, bolstered by advancements in app-based technology, is changing the paradigm of car ownership. Ride-sharing services and car subscriptions offer flexible solutions that align with evolving urban lifestyles.

The Challenges Ahead

While the future of automotive technology is bright, it is not without challenges. Issues such as data privacy, cybersecurity, and the economic impact of job displacement due to automation must be addressed. Additionally, the widespread adoption of new technologies depends on regulatory support, public acceptance, and the coordinated development of infrastructure.
